Vpn推荐 github:github上值得关注的开源vpn项目和指南 2026版的快速指南
一个简短的事实:开源 VPN 项目在 GitHub 上持续活跃,2026 年的趋势聚焦隐私保护、性能优化与跨平台兼容性。
- 想要快速了解吗?本篇文章将带你完整浏览:
- 常见的开源 VPN 项目与代码库结构
- 如何评估、部署与测试 VPN 服务
- 与商业 VPN 的对比、优劣势与风险点
- 安全性、隐私政策与合规性要点
- 常见问题解答与实用资源
快速提醒:如果你在找一个可靠的 VPN 解决方案,以下某些开源项目、指南和工具在 2026 年仍然是社区活跃核心。为了帮助你更快上手,文中会提供可直接参考的资源清单。你也可以通过以下 Affiliate 链接了解更多优选方案:NordVPN 相关信息与特别优惠(点击查看),以便在需要商业服务时进行对比。
- 了解开源 VPN 的基本概念与分类
- 顶级开源 VPN 项目概览(按用途分组)
- 安全性与隐私:你需要知道的关键点
- 部署与测试流程:从本地到云端的实操
- 维护、贡献与参与开源社区的方法
- 常见问题解答(FAQ)
一、开源 VPN 的基本概念与分类
- VPN 的核心目标:在不可靠的网络环境下提供私密、加密的通信通道,隐藏用户的网络行为,保护数据不被窃听。
- 开源 vs 专有:开源项目允许任何人查看、审查和贡献代码,有助于发现漏洞、提升透明度,但同时需要用户自行评估维护状态与安全性。
- 常见架构:
- 传输层 VPN(如 WireGuard、OpenVPN)——基于现有协议栈,易于跨平台实现
- 应用层代理(如 Shadowsocks、V2Ray)——更灵活,常用于绕过网络限制
- 自托管解决方案(Self-Hosted)——将 VPN 服务部署在自有服务器,提升控制权
- 评估要点:活跃度、维护频率、提交的漏洞修复、社区贡献者数量、官方文档完整性、单元测试覆盖率。
二、顶级开源 VPN 项目概览(按用途分组)
注:以下项目在 GitHub 上具备高活跃度、完善文档与较强社区支持。阅读时记得核对最新状态,因为开源生态更新很快。
A. WireGuard 为核心的现代 VPN 框架
- 项目要点:WireGuard 是一个简单且高效的 VPN 协议,具备极低的延迟和良好的性能。很多开源实现都是围绕 WireGuard 打造的。
- 使用场景:点对点连接、企业网网关、个人隐私保护等
- 相关资源:官方库、跨平台实现、性能优化指南
B. OpenVPN 派生与社区工具
- 项目要点:OpenVPN 仍然是成熟稳定的选择,社区中有多种自托管解决方案、图形化管理界面和自动化运维工具。
- 使用场景:需要广泛设备支持、对兼容性要求高的场景
- 相关资源:客户端集成、服务器端配置模板、脚本化部署
C. 自托管的 VPN 服务套件 Proton vpn 安裝指南:2026 年最佳 vpn 教程 windows mac ⭐ android ios 全面解析與實作
- 项目要点:包括端到端的用户管理、证书颁发、流量统计与日志管理等
- 使用场景:中小型团队、个人博客/自建服务器、教育和演示环境
- 相关资源:部署脚本、容器化方案(如 Docker/Compose、Kubernetes),监控告警集成
D. 代理+隧道组合方案
- 项目要点: Shadoshocks、V2Ray、Xray 等项目在自定义代理与混合隧道方面有丰富实现,可用于应对网络封锁与绕过限制
- 使用场景:需要绕过地区性审查、需要灵活的分流策略
- 相关资源:客户端配置模板、路由规则示例、跨平台支持
E. 审计与安全工具
- 项目要点:专注于安全审计、漏洞扫描、密钥管理和安全合规性工具,帮助提升自建 VPN 的安全性
- 使用场景:企业或高隐私需求场景
- 相关资源:静态代码分析、依赖项管理、密钥轮换工具
三、安全性与隐私:你需要知道的关键点
- 数据最小化原则:尽量减少日志记录、避免收集敏感信息。
- 加密强度与协议更新:优先选择零信任和端到端加密设计,关注协议版本升级。
- 证书与密钥管理:定期轮换、使用短寿命证书、避免弱密码与默认凭证。
- 审计与透明度:选择有公开安全审计记录的项目,关注漏洞披露与响应时间。
- 兼容性与可信源:从官方仓库、可信的分支分发构建版本,避免未知来源。
四、部署与测试流程:从本地到云端的实操
A. 环境准备
- 选择操作系统:Linux(Ubuntu/DentOS)、macOS、Windows、以及对嵌入式系统的支持
- 依赖与工具:Docker、Kubernetes、Ansible、Terraform 等自动化工具
B. 快速部署模板 Protonmail 與 VPN 的結合:全面保護上網隱私的實戰指南
- 使用 WireGuard 的简单网关部署脚本
- 基于 OpenVPN 的服务器端配置模板
- 自托管套件的 Docker Compose 示例
C. 性能与稳定性测试
- 延迟测试:Ping、Traceroute、iperf3
- 通过putty/ssh等方式远程验证隧道稳定性
- 带宽与吞吐量基准测试,比较不同加密参数对性能的影响
- 同时连接数与并发场景的压力测试
D. 安全性测试
- 漏洞扫面的执行:常用的静态/动态分析工具
- TLS/证书链检查:验证证书有效期、吊销列表、CA 信任设置
- 日志审查:确保不记录不必要的用户敏感信息,便于事后审计
E. 监控与运维
- 指标:连接数、带宽 utilization、错误率、延迟分布
- 告警:CPU/内存、磁盘、网络错误与异常流量
- 自动化:通过 CI/CD 部署与回滚策略实现快速迭代
五、维护、贡献与参与开源社区的方法
- 参与方式:提 Bug、提交 Pull Request、撰写使用指南、编写测试用例
- 社区礼仪:清晰描述问题、提供可复现步骤、遵循代码风格
- 安全贡献:对安全相关的改动进行独立审查,遵循披露流程
- 文档与本地化:为不同语言社区提供文档译本,扩大普及度
六、结合商业 VPN 的对比与注意事项 梯子免费加速器:全面指南、選擇與風險評估,提升上網速度與隱私保護
- 优势对比:商业 VPN 提供商通常提供稳定的服务等级、商业级支持和全球节点,但隐私控制较弱,且依赖第三方服务
- 风险点:日志策略、数据留存、司法审查与数据请求等
- 自托管的权衡:需要时间、技术能力与持续维护,但隐私与控制也更高
- 选择要点:目标使用场景、预算、对隐私与合规性要求、对性能的期望
七、实用资源与参考
以下是一些常用的、在社区中广泛认可的资源,便于你快速上手、对照学习。
- WireGuard 官方资源与实现
- OpenVPN 社区与指南
- 自托管 VPN 的容器化部署模板
- 跨平台客户端与配置示例
- 安全审计工具与密钥管理实践
重要资源清单(文本形式,非链接)
- Apple Website – apple.com
- Artificial Intelligence Wikipedia – en.wikipedia.org/wiki/Artificial_intelligence
- GitHub – github.com
- WireGuard 官方文档 – www.wireguard.com
- OpenVPN 官方文档 – openvpn.net
- Self-Hosted VPN 模板合集 – github.com
- Docker Compose 示例 – docs.docker.com/compose
- Kubernetes VPN 部署指南 – kubernetes.io/docs/tasks/administer-cluster/
八、附带的实用操作清单
- 设定目标:明确你需要保护的对象、节点与设备
- 选择核心协议:WireGuard 作为首选(性能优、代码简洁)
- 部署前评估:检查节点位置、带宽、合规性要求
- 证书与密钥管理:制定轮换计划、备份策略
- 日志策略:定制最小日志化设置,确保可追溯性
- 监控与告警:设置关键指标、建立故障应对流程
- 社区参与:跟踪官方仓库的 Issue 与 PR,参与贡献
常见问题解答
1. 开源 VPN 是否比商业 VPN 更安全?
开源 VPN 的安全性取决于实现质量、维护活跃度和自我审计。开源让你可以看到代码、参与审查,但也要求你对维护状态有清晰判断。商业 VPN 提供商通常提供 SLA、支持与服务,但隐私政策需仔细阅读,且数据控制权较低。 中国国际机场vpn:全面指南與實用技巧,含安全與僱用實務的深入分析
2. WireGuard 与 OpenVPN 的主要区别是什么?
WireGuard 更轻量、性能更好、代码简洁,适合高性能场景;OpenVPN 更成熟、兼容性广,支持更多认证方式与复杂场景。实际选择常常取决于设备支持与部署需求。
3. 自托管 VPN 是否适合个人用户?
如果你愿意投入时间学习、愿意自主管理服务器与安全性,完全可以。对多数普通用户,商业解决方案提供了便捷性与稳定性,但隐私控制与成本需权衡。
4. 如何评估一个开源 VPN 项目的健康度?
查看最近的提交时间、合并请求的处理速度、测试覆盖率、官方文档完整性、社区活跃度和 Issue 的关闭响应时间。
5. 部署开源 VPN 时,最容易出错的地方是什么?
没有做好证书/密钥管理、日志记录过多或者未正确配置防火墙与路由,都会带来安全与性能问题。
6. 自托管和云部署的成本差异大吗?
初期成本取决于服务器规格与节点数量,长期而言,运维成本、带宽与安全维护将成为主要支出项。 Vpn梯子:全面指南與實用技巧,提升上網自由與安全
7. 如何确保 VPN 使用中的隐私?
限制日志、采用强加密、定期更新软件、使用最小权限的账户、对外暴露的端点要做访问控制。
8. 开源 VPN 项目的文档通常如何?
良好的项目会提供快速开始、运维指南、架构图、示例配置、常见问题解答和贡献指南。
9. 是否需要专业的安全审计来使用开源 VPN?
对高敏感场景,建议进行独立的安全审计,确保没有潜在漏洞;对于普通用途,保持更新、遵循最佳实践也能大幅提升安全性。
10. 如何参与开源 VPN 社区?
从阅读官方文档开始,尝试提交小型修复、提供使用场景反馈、贡献本地化翻译、参与讨论与需求梳理。
请注意:本文提供的是对开源 VPN 领域的全面导览与实操要点。若你对具体某个项目感兴趣,建议直接在 GitHub 上走进对应的代码库,阅读 README、Getting Started、和 Wiki,以获取最准确的部署步骤与版本信息。 免费代理服务器列表:2026年最新可用代理及安全替代方案指南
本文章中嵌入的 Affiliate 内容用于帮助你了解更多可选方案,相关链接保持现有文本格式,以便你自行核对与点击。
如果你需要我把其中的某一个分支、具体项目的部署步骤、或是将内容细化成一个逐步的视频脚本,请告诉我你偏好的目标场景(个人隐私保护、企业自建网关、跨境访问等),我可以据此进一步定制。
Sources:
Nordvpn on iphone your ultimate guide to security freedom: Stay Safe, Private, and Free Online
国内vpn服务:全方位指南與實用評測,提升你的網路自由與保護 2026年如何安全稳定地访问中国大陆以外的网站:最完整指南與實用技巧
